Precision Drawn Seamless Honed Steel Tube for Critical Applications

For applications requiring the utmost precision, cold drawn seamless honed steel tube stands out as the ideal choice. This high-performance material undergoes a meticulous manufacturing process that begins with drawing seamless tubing from high-quality steel. Subsequently, it is honed to achieve a surface finish of exceptional smoothness and flatness. This refined surface minimizes friction and ensures optimal performance in demanding environments.

The honed surface also enhances the tube's wear properties, making it particularly suitable for applications involving challenging situations. The seamless construction further complements its structural integrity, ensuring reliable performance under pressure and load. Cold drawn seamless honed steel tube finds widespread use in various industries, including automotive, where its exceptional properties are essential for achieving peak performance.

Precise Dimensions Delivered by Cold Drawn Seamless Steel Tube

Cold drawn seamless steel tubes are renowned for their exceptional dimensional accuracy. This attribute stems from the cold drawing process itself, which involves gradually reducing the tube's diameter while imparting a significant amount of compressive stress. This process not only enhances strength and hardness but also refines the internal and external dimensions to within very tight tolerances.

The unmatched precision of cold drawn seamless steel tubes makes them the ideal choice for applications where dimensional consistency is essential. These tubes find widespread use in industries such as manufacturing, where even minor deviations can have profound consequences.
